Day 9 - Penrith to Sanquhar - projected distance 80 miles.

Bright and breezy this morning. But that’s enough about me: the weather was pretty good too, with a (rare) blue sky in Penrith. Today was all set to be a pivotal day, mainly because of the journey over the border to Scotland.

Out of Penrith and on the road to Carlisle, I passed the village of Unthank and gave thanks for my morning’s ride. There were more lovely views to enjoy. Everywhere looks better in the sunshine, and Carlisle was no exception. Passing rows of manicured lawns and shiny cars, I reached the twin castles which feature in the town centre. Then it was out into the countryside again, and on towards Gretna, which made me glad I was wearing white today.

And there it was. Scotland. Right by the border – literally, right by the border, stood the first house in Scotland, where more than 10,000 marriages have been conducted (so the sign says). After some photos by the Scotland sign, I vowed to press on, past Lockerbie and into Dumfries, where I met up with Sarah and the children for picnic by the River Nith. It was, if you will, a picnith.

After Dumfries I passed some signs for Moniaive, where the McHattie family bakery was, then it was on through Thornhill and uphill to Sanquhar, home of the world’s oldest Post Office (1751). Today I posted an 82-mile ride, which is the longest to date.

Yes, I am tired, and yes, the strains of the challenge are starting to tell. Unfortunately I do have the first signs of saddle-soreness, which feels almost like a bruising around the bones. More problematically, my bike’s gears have been playing up all day and are running very badly, so I need to find a friendly bike shop in Glasgow to have a look at the gearset tomorrow.
